Bio

I am a native of Barren County Kentucky. My parents are the late James and Doris 'Groce' Smith. They are buried at Cedar Flats Cemetery in Metcalfe County Ky. I now live in Plainfield, Indiana and have been married to my husband, and (my best friend) Timothy Smith since 1970. I have two beautiful, congenial daughters, Penny and LaWana, and five precious grand children: Levi, Lacey, Carl, Melanie and Michael. Michael and Melanie are twins.
I am in the medical field for a large heart hospital in Indianapolis, Indiana; Maybe if I lose mine, they'll find me a new one. :)
My hobbies are writing Poems, Sewing, Photography, Crocheting, and most dear to my heart, is my art. I am a professional landscape artist in oils, and I do portraits in charcoals. I dabble in other mediums time permitting. I love genealogy....and my little shih-tzu dog Augie.
I have one sister, Judy Wilson who I am very close to, and proud of. She is a psychiatric counselor in south central Ky. Besides that, my sister is a very talented woman, and a hoot when we are together. No one can make me laugh like my sister can. I have three living brothers: Eddie, Gary and Larry, and one who passed away (Jerry) in 2006. I love my friends, co workers and family. I have been truely blessed in this life. When I look back on my youth I always Thank God for many of my unanswered prayers.
